“A wise option if you have a dog friend travelling with you”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ed 31 December 2011

Our choice to stay at the Ambrose was determined by our desire to bring our doggie friend with us on our trip. So to all pet lovers who are looking for a lovely hotel , close to ocean avenue , 3rd street promenade and Santa Monica pier, it is the right place for you without the price tag of Loews or casa del mar near by. Just mention that you have a dog (30 lbs max) and you will get a room on the first floor . The room was ok , not luxurious , just appointed right for the price, the bedding satisfactory without being impressive. i think the ratio amenities and price is adequate for the area.
The free continental breakfast is good , fully garnished with tastful pastries and starbucks coffee
The underground and protected parking is a real plus for the area
And the pet fee of $30 is acceptable .
Hotel is clean , more loke a discret little retreat, front desk was polite and attentive, so far we are very satisfied with our stay and will go back there when needed. We had a great time with our young dog and having him with us made our Christmas even more special.

“If you can get it at a discount, go for it!”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ed 28 December 2011
6
people found this review helpful

We were able to book a premium king room for $164 through tablet.com. The usual rate is more like $225. Our room was small but clean and nicely decorated. We had a very tiny balcony--not worth paying extra for it. The bed was comfortable. The pillows were not. The shower was adequate but nothing special. And we had to run the fan to mask noise from adjoining rooms and overhead. The breakfast is excellent if you like carbs, but at least the pastries are "real," not the usual cellophane-wrapped cardboard served at hotel breakfast bars. There was also yogurt, dry cereal, and fresh strawberries. The desk clerk (Linda, I think) was outstanding. We were accidentally put in a standard room. When we pointed out the error, she was very gracious and accommodating in making sure we got the room we had paid for.

BOTTOM LINE: If you can get the room at a discount (or if you're willing to pay extra for a better-than-average hotel breakfast), this is a good bet. If you have to pay full price, there are less expensive options in town.

“Sweet Boutique Hotel”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 22 December 2011

We were in Santa Monica for 3 days in the end of September for a friend's wedding and while the rest of the wedding party stayed at the Doubletree, we opted for the similarly priced Ambrose. I'm glad we made that decision because the Ambrose felt much more homey. Breakfast was quite good, and we were able to park our rental car in the basement garage, making everything very convenient. Staff were super friendly and helpful with making suggestions of where to go in Santa Monica for the best Mexican food. Great stay overall!

“An oasis in Santa Monica”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 18 December 2011
1
person found this review helpful

We arrived several hours before check-in time, and as our room was not ready we were offerred a downgrade to a room that was available. Downgrade? The room we were given was delightful! We were on the ground floor, closest to the intersection. We had a private patio, that was a lovely place to sit with a newspaper & a cup of coffee.There was very minimal noise, as this hotel is on a tree-lined residential street. Yes, it is a very long walk to the beach. But the Ambrose has a London cab that will transport you within Santa Monica. Continental breakfast is included, and it's a pleasant meal - fresh berries, quality pastry, organic yoghurt, etc. - served in the lobby area or outside on the patio. When we return to Santa Monica, we will definitely stay at the Ambrose.

“A great ambience of serenity, simplicity and great location”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 3 December 2011
1
person found this review helpful

When I read the reviews of Trip Advisor, I was excited at the same time had concerns about the noise and other issues that I read. After the talk I had with Alex Cortez of the front desk, he put my mind at ease and true to his word, our 2 day stay was wonderful. I would also like to commend Linda Crocker, also of the front desk for all the helpful infomation about Sta. Monica. Early check-in was available and the room in the third floor was overlooking the garden and was quiet for the most part. It felt like a cozy, serene, simple home away from home.
Great free breakfast of fresh strawberries, delicious muffins and Tazo teas. Location was great, walking distance to the promenade and Santa Monica Pier( from what I have heard from the people who walked, about 25 minute walk), Wallgreens, CVS and to Wilshire Blvd. which has restaurants that one can enjoy. The staff were helpful and friendly.
My husband and I would like to come back in the near future.
We would definitely recommend this hotel to our family and friends.
